Scott McLaughlin: From New Zealand to IndyCar

When Scott McLaughlin joined IndyCar, he wasn’t just hopping from one race series to another: He was leaping across hemispheres and disciplines. The New Zealander made his debut with the series in 2021 alongside a stacked rookie field that included former Formula driver Romain Grosjean and seven-time NASCAR Cup Series champion Jimmie Johnson.

A New Challenge

For McLaughlin, the move to IndyCar represented a new challenge in his racing career. After dominating the Australian Supercars Championship for three consecutive years, winning the title in 2018, 2019, and 2020, McLaughlin was ready to test his skills against some of the best drivers in the world.

IndyCar is known for its high-speed oval races, as well as its demanding road and street courses. McLaughlin had to quickly adapt to the different tracks and racing strategies employed in the series. Despite being a rookie, he showed impressive speed and consistency throughout the season.

Joining Team Penske

McLaughlin joined Team Penske, one of the most successful teams in IndyCar history. The team has a long-standing reputation for excellence and has won multiple championships over the years. McLaughlin’s teammates included experienced drivers like Will Power and Josef Newgarden, who provided valuable guidance and support as he navigated his way through his rookie season.

Being part of Team Penske also meant having access to top-notch equipment and resources. The team’s engineers and mechanics worked closely with McLaughlin to fine-tune his car setup and maximize his performance on track. This level of support undoubtedly played a crucial role in his successful transition to IndyCar.

Impressive Results

Despite the challenges of adapting to a new series, McLaughlin had several standout performances during his rookie season. He consistently qualified well and showcased his overtaking skills in races. One of his most memorable moments came at the Texas Motor Speedway, where he finished second, narrowly missing out on his first IndyCar victory.

McLaughlin’s strong performances earned him recognition as one of the top rookies in the series. He finished the season with multiple top-ten finishes and ended up 13th in the championship standings. Considering the competitiveness of IndyCar and the steep learning curve for rookies, this was an impressive achievement.
